The Japanese Chin is a small, elegant dog that has a rich history dating back to ancient times. Originally bred as companion dogs for royalty and nobility in Japan, Japanese Chins are known for their charming and affectionate nature. They have a distinctive appearance with a short muzzle, large expressive eyes, and a profuse coat that comes in a variety of colors.
Japanese Chins are known for their playful and friendly demeanor, making them excellent family pets. They are highly intelligent and eager to please, making them easy to train. Despite their small size, Japanese Chins are lively and energetic dogs that enjoy playing and going for walks.
The Tibetan Terrier is another ancient breed that originates from Tibet, where they were bred by monks as companions and watchdogs. Despite their name, Tibetan Terriers are not true terriers but rather a unique breed with a long, shaggy coat and a friendly, outgoing personality.
Tibetan Terriers are known for their loyalty and affection towards their families. They are highly intelligent and independent dogs that can be quite reserved with strangers but are very loving towards their owners. Tibetan Terriers require regular grooming to maintain their long coat and are known for their agility and athleticism.
